Local dealers usually just stick higher mileage trade ins through the auctions but that costs them time & money, make them an offer - I've picked up some cheap vans this way.
Failing that BCA vantastic @ Derby or Newport http://www.british-car-auctions.co.uk/default.aspx?page=3218
